Предлагаемый способ может быть реализован в установке, включающей в себя ДВС, термохимический реактор, тепловой аккумулятор , смесители и топливную магистраль.The invention relates to mechanical engineering, in particular to engine building, and in particular to methods of powering internal combustion engines (ICE) with thermochemical conversion of liquid hydrocarbon fuel. The proposed method of powering the internal combustion engine allows to increase the efficiency of operation at idle and the share loads at steady state, as well as in a wide range of unsteady modes by maintaining a constant conversion temperature due to the engine exhaust heat accumulated in the thermal accumulator during its operation at nominal and close to rated loads. The proposed method can be implemented in the installation, which includes the internal combustion engine, thermochemical reactor, heat accumulator, mixers and fuel line.
